/**
 * A unified search interface that provides search capabilities across partitioned vector databases.
 *
 * @class UnifiedSearch
 * @extends {EventEmitter}
 * @description
 * UnifiedSearch wraps a partitioned vector database to provide a unified search API
 * with advanced features like search method selection (HNSW/clustered), reranking,
 * metadata fetching, and performance tracking.
 *
 * The class handles:
 * - Vector similarity search using partitioned vector databases
 * - Automatic method selection between HNSW and clustered search
 * - Optional result reranking for diversity or other criteria
 * - Metadata fetching and inclusion in results
 * - Performance metrics and statistics
 *
 * @fires UnifiedSearch#search:complete - Emitted when a search completes successfully
 * @fires UnifiedSearch#search:error - Emitted when a search encounters an error
 * @fires UnifiedSearch#search:closed - Emitted when the search engine is closed
 *
 * @example
 * ```typescript
 * // Create a UnifiedSearch instance with a partitioned vector database
 * const search = new UnifiedSearch(vectorDb, { debug: true });
 *
 * // Perform a search with unified options
 * const results = await search.search(queryVector, {
 *   k: 20,
 *   rerank: true,
 *   rerankingMethod: 'diversity',
 *   includeMetadata: true
 * });
 * ```
 */
